- N-PLURAL (国王、王后、总统等要人居住的)套间,套房
Theapartmentsof an important person such as a king, queen, or president are a set of large rooms which are used by them.- ...the private apartments of the Prince of Wales at St James's Palace.
威尔士亲王在圣詹姆斯宫的私人套房
